How RCWL-1601 Ultrasonic Sensor Works

The sensor uses ultrasonic waves to measure distance.

Working principle:

  1. The controller sends a trigger signal.
  2. The ultrasonic transmitter emits a 40kHz sound wave.
  3. The wave reflects from an object.
  4. The receiving circuit detects the echo signal.
  5. Distance is calculated based on signal travel time.

Formula:

Distance = Echo Time × Sound Speed / 2

Technical Specifications

Parameter Specification
Product Name RCWL-1601 Ultrasonic Distance Sensor Module
Compatibility HC-SR04 Compatible
Operating Voltage 3V-5.5V
Working Frequency 40kHz
Maximum Detection Distance Approx. 450cm
Blind Zone Approx. 2cm
Accuracy ±2%
Resolution 1mm
Detection Angle ≤15°
Interface Mode GPIO
Operating Temperature -10℃ to 60℃

Pin Definition

Pin Function
VCC Power Supply
Trig Trigger Signal
Echo Echo Output
GND Ground
NC No Connection
3V 3V Output
